Output 0580e7c9038387eed39f064bf2c90f0a287a47bac61638a06e7e4fecb6e2a1a4:0

value
1312913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4ed794d83349688e4f045e1b588deef63a71a2 OP_EQUAL
address
3Jg84GdrqCKKWAm9V5r4n8eF8SWN7Vh6Kn
transaction
0580e7c9038387eed39f064bf2c90f0a287a47bac61638a06e7e4fecb6e2a1a4
confirmations
331272
spent
true